MAS Financial successfully secured INR 360 crores through Senior Secured NCDs issued to FMO. This capital injection aims to support the growth of women, youth, and rural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s). The NCDs were listed on BSE for a 5-year tenure.
MAS Financial has introduced secured Non-Convertible Debentures (NCDs) worth INR 360 crores, rated CARE AA/Stable with a maturity of 5 years. The debentures offer semi-annual interest and will be repaid in six installments over the tenure.

MAS Financial maintains its high credit rating of AA from Acuite Ratings, thanks to robust asset growth, enhanced earnings, strong capital position, and consistent profitability. The outlook remains stable.
MAS Financial's Q4 profits saw a substantial 25% increase to ₹104 crore, compared to last year, primarily due to strong growth in lending activities. Quarterly revenue reached ₹542 crore, marking a 23% rise.

MAS Financial aims to reach a whopping Rs 1 trillion Assets Under Management (AUM) by 2036, anticipating an impressive annual growth of 20-25%.
MAS Financial Services has invested ₹25 crore in their subsidiary, MAS Rural Housing & Mortgage Finance Ltd., purchasing a 1.2% equity stake. This investment aims to bolster liquidity, provide working capital, and facilitate growth within the housing finance sector of their subsidiary.
